This list provides Mercedes part numbers for items useful to LX owners.

Ok, first item is the transmission dipstick
This allows checking the fluid level without having to use the starscan for tranny temps.
140 589 15 21 00

Trans Pan w/drain plug
140 270 08 12

Transmission Pan Gasket
Normal maintenance part
140 271 00 80

Transmission Filter
Normal maintenance part
140 277 00 95

Transmission Electrical plug Adapter with O-rings.
You need this if you have a leak at the plug on the transmission.
203 540 02 53

Transmission Electrical plug Adapter O-rings.
These are replacement o-rings for the above plug.
026 997 40 48 28
026 997 41 48 28

Blue Top Transmission Solenoids
These will increase line pressure and therefore shift firmness in the 5 speed NAG1 Tranny.
240 270 00 89

Rear Diff Cooler and required Diff Cover for 215mm rear
Keep those rears cooled off.
Cooler: 171 351 0108
Cover: 204 351 05 08
Thanks to Jim McVeigh

Parking Brake Pedal Cover (Matches Mopar Pedal Covers)
203 430 00 84
!!!May need a bit of trimming to the rubber back in Auto cars!!!
Thanks to Speedy at Challengertalk.com

will the blue tops cause any weirdness with the ECM? have heard diff things on this topic.
 
#53 ·
^^^ No. "If" you change both as you should then the ECM doesnt know the difference. The variations that have issues are either trying to use a valve body mod, silver box, or some other mod/device in conjunction with the blue tops. The blue tops work great all by themselves and there are plenty of folks that can attest to that fact. They work all the time everytime

From SLR 722 Transmission Solenoids Valves - MBWorld.org Forums

SLR 722 Transmission Solenoids Valves[HR][/HR]
As I suspect is commonly known, the current part numbers for the E55 and Maybach 722 transmissions solenoid and pressure control valves are now the same (A 240 270 01 80 & A 240 270 00 89). However, the same valves for the SLR 722 transmission are different (A 240 270 00 80 & (A 240 270 02 89.
